Key Points:

  • Colon cancer, once considered primarily an older adult disease, has become the leading cause of cancer-related deaths in people under 50, prompting increased awareness efforts by Katie Couric following her husband's death from the disease at age 42.
  • Couric emphasizes the importance of healthy lifestyle habits, such as eating mostly whole, plant-based foods and avoiding ultra-processed foods and charred meats, to help reduce cancer risk.
  • Regular exercise, including Pilates, walking, and strength training, is highlighted by Couric as a key factor in maintaining overall health and potentially lowering cancer risk.
  • Screening remains the most effective method for early detection and prevention of colon cancer; colonoscopies can detect and remove precancerous polyps, with recommendations now starting at age 45 for average-risk individuals.
  • At-home stool tests like Cologuard offer a convenient screening alternative, especially for those hesitant to undergo colonoscopy, and Couric urges people to overcome embarrassment and prioritize timely cancer screenings.
